如何使用node.js twit获取用户的twitterstream?

我正在使用node.js Twit模块; 用户通过身份validation后,如何获取该用户的推文? 文档没有解释如何去做。

以下内容返回null:

var Twit=require('twit'); var T = new Twit({ consumer_key: nconf.get('twitterAuth:consumerKey') , consumer_secret: nconf.get('twitterAuth:consumerSecret') , access_token: user.token , access_token_secret: user.tokenSecret }); var username=user.profile.username; T.get('search/tweets', {screen_name: username, count:100 }, function(err, data, response) { //q: 'banana since:2011-11-11', count: 100 res.send(data); }) 

感谢任何帮助 – 一定是明显的东西。 (我已经确认了代码作品)。

       

网上收集的解决方案 "如何使用node.js twit获取用户的twitterstream?"

你可能已经解决了你的问题,但是对于那些正在努力的人来说,这里是我的解决scheme:

 var Twit = require('twit'); var T = new Twit({ consumer_key: '' , consumer_secret: '' , access_token: '' , access_token_secret: '' }) var options = { screen_name: 'sandagolcea', count: 3 }; T.get('statuses/user_timeline', options , function(err, data) { for (var i = 0; i < data.length ; i++) { console.log(data[i].text); } }) 

这显示了我的最后3个推文:)干杯!